Transaction 61fe8367ad2144962530e2d212f86821ed0499cb8e37741945941077fbae08a6
1 Input
1 Output
-
61fe8367ad2144962530e2d212f86821ed0499cb8e37741945941077fbae08a6:0
- value
- 138900
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c8a8a65e0889d3af6bcd52fd186111d65fe3f72 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FGiNtzPgFJ6AvfzJo3sNPu5QJHDkMo7QH